Safetronic 2026

Holistic Safety for Road Vehicles

For the sixth time, the Fraunhofer Institute for Cognitive Systems IKS will host the international conference “Safetronic” in 2026, which celebrates its 25th anniversary this year. The event will take place on November 18 and 19, 2026.

Safetronic offers valuable exchanges with experts from renowned companies and an excellent opportunity to network with partners.

In addition to exciting reports on experiences and innovative solutions from leading OEMs and the supplier industry, the conference will feature interactive formats.

The conference is primarily aimed at companies from the automotive manufacturing and supplier, electronics/electrical engineering, software development, and mechanical engineering industries, as well as research institutes.

Participants work in the fields of research and development, design/product development, quality management, software development, and technical sales.

 

Practical update on trends and developments

  • ISO 26262, SOTIF, cybersecurity, and safety in use
  • Successful implementation
  • Innovative safety concepts for connectivity, autonomous driving, artificial intelligence, and electrification
